Rosenberg and his team have permission from the National Institutes of Health and the Food and Drug Administration to treat 15 people with TNF-gene- altered cells, including patients with advanced kidney or colon cancer. Another 15 individuals with the same diseases may receive injections of tumor cells that have been genetically altered to produce interleukin-2 -- a protein that stimulates tumor-fighting lymphocytes -- instead of TNF. All the patients have failed to respond to standard therapy...
